Ingredients
- 1 cup butter, softened
- 1 cup white sugar
- 1 cup light brown sugar
- 2 large eggs
- 2 tsp vanilla extract
- 3 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 tsp baking soda
- 2 tsp hot water
- 0.5 tsp salt
- 2 cups semisweet chocolate chips
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
- Cream butter and sugars until smooth. Beat in eggs one at a time, then stir in vanilla.
- Dissolve baking soda in hot water. Add to batter along with salt.
- Stir in flour and chocolate chips.
- Drop spoonfuls onto ungreased pan. Bake 10 mins.
Ingredient Highlights & Substitutions
Essential Ingredients
- Room Temp Butter: Softened butter is key for easier mixing and better aeration.
- Light Brown Sugar: We use light brown sugar for a milder, sweeter flavor compared to dark brown.
- All-Purpose Flour: Just standard white flour. No fancy cake or bread flours needed.
- Chocolate Chips: Semi-sweet is standard, but this recipe is a blank canvas for milk or white chocolate.
- Eggs: Standard large eggs provide structure.
Smart Substitutions
- Shortening: You can replace half the butter with vegetable shortening for a cookie that is fluffier and spreads less.
- Mix-ins: Feel free to add 1/2 cup of chopped nuts or dried fruit.
- Extracts: Almond extract (just 1/2 tsp) adds a lovely “bakery” scent.

Pro Tips for Perfect Results
Technique Secrets
If you want perfectly uniform cookies, weigh your dough balls (approx 35g each). This ensures they all bake at the exact same rate.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
Don’t melt the butter! If you melt it, the cookies will be greasy and flat. It must be softened (room temp).
